Career path
| Career Role (Behavioral Economics in Healthcare) | Description |
|---|---|
| Healthcare Behavioral Economist (Senior) | Leads complex behavioral economics projects, influencing policy and strategy within large healthcare organizations. Extensive experience in research, data analysis, and program evaluation are key. |
| Health Policy Analyst (Behavioral Insights) | Analyzes healthcare policies using behavioral economics principles, advising on interventions to improve outcomes. Strong analytical & communication skills vital. |
| Behavioral Science Consultant (Healthcare) | Applies behavioral science principles to improve healthcare service delivery and patient engagement. Requires consultancy experience and strong project management skills. |
| Patient Engagement Specialist (Behavioral Economics) | Designs and implements strategies to improve patient adherence to treatment plans, utilizing insights from behavioral economics. Requires excellent communication and interpersonal skills. |
